My DD is 17 days old and we just had a routine pedi appt where I said she spit up after maybe half her daytime feeds, maybe a tablespoon or less. Today, however, she's spitting five or six times after every feed, teaspoon or more each time. Pedi already said that he doesn't want to do anything for reflux until 2-3 months and I burp her religiously every time she pulls off. What do I do for her?
